MP3 principal showcases student robotics, warns LEGO EV3 curriculum is being phased out

Meridian School Board · February 20, 2025

MP3 principal Michelle Bridal recognized five eighth graders for robotics work, demonstrated an EV3 robot, and described MP3’s self-sustaining finances, assessment routines and plans to migrate from LEGO EV3 to other curricula as vendor support ends.

Michelle Bridal, principal at MP3, used the Meridian School Board meeting on Feb. 19 to highlight student robotics and to outline curricular and budget details for the alternative learning program.

Bridal introduced students being recognized for robotics and invited a pair to demonstrate an EV3 robot, explaining that “once you program it with the computer, you can download it to the robot, and it remembers it.” She said MP3 offers Lego STEM and VEX robotics and that students appreciate VEX’s movable parts and controller options.
